Turkey baked potatoes (stolen from Citybites by me.)
what you need:
Large baking potatoes, I prefer Idaho russets.
Box of stove top turkey stuffing
1/2 stick butter, melted
2 turkey gravy (your choice jars, can, packets)
1 lb Deli sliced turkey.
Preheat oven to 350 degrees
Wash potatoes, dry and poke holes into potatoes with fork, then wrap each in tinfoil and place in oven on lowest rack.
Do whatever you want for the next two hours or so. Depending how fast your oven bakes.
Cook stuffing according to package directions.
In a medium sauce pan, combine gravy and turkey. Cook on low until hot.
In a small sauce pan, melt butter.
Take potatoes out of oven. Unwrap and slice down the middle. Pour butter over potatoes. Then spoon stuffing on top, finally topping with gravy and turkey.
